1999 GMC Sierra 1500 problems & reliability

158 owner complaints filed with NHTSA for the 1999 GMC Sierra 1500, alongside 1 safety recall campaign. Last verified Aug 7, 2026. Complaints are unverified reports submitted by owners to the federal Office of Defects Investigation.

Mileage when problems occurred

Half of the failures with a reported odometer reading occurred by 107,000 miles (middle 50% between 65,750 and 150,621 miles), based on 128 complaints that included mileage.

What owners report

  • ABS Brakes cut out leaving you with little to no brakes. No warning light appears. This continues on and off over time. Then that ABS warning light came on. When the warning light was on, brakes worked just not ABS. Light would go out and back to the original issue. Took it in to dealership when the light remained on…

    Service Brakes · filed Sep 25, 2021

  • I was driving home from work on 421 in eminence, ky. I pushed the brake pedal & I had no brakes right in front of harry hill park. Gm & I are very lucky that no one was killed yesterday. The brake line corroded & leaked the brake fluid, so when I pushed the pedal, it went right to the floor. The vehicle is pretty…

    Service Brakes · filed Apr 27, 2019

  • I got under the truck to change the oil then I noticed a crack in the frame where the cross member is. Cross member runs across frame support

    Unknown OR Other · filed Oct 15, 2018

Verbatim excerpts from complaints filed with NHTSA. Reports are not independently verified.

TSBs are repair guidance manufacturers send to dealers — they are not recalls and repairs are not automatically free. Full documents are available on NHTSA’s site.
